Car strikes deer on Route 4 west, driver unharmedRutland County VT

audio iconTraffic
US-4, Vermont

A car hit a deer on Route 4 west near mile marker 16.4. The driver was not injured and the vehicle can still be driven. The deer is still alive and in the road. A wildlife officer was notified to remove the deer.
